The 2023 US Roadshows, characterized by top industry leaders’ participation from Gusto, Poe Group Advisors, and futurist Elatia Abate, successfully unfolded an impressive platform to reveal riveting features from tech giant Xero.

With engaging events hosted in leading tech hubs including Austin, Atlanta, and Los Angeles, the consensus was clear: the future is here. Concentrating on unveiling current and upcoming product updates, Xero has now surely become the talk of the town for its groundbreaking innovations.

A standout highlight was the reveal of the new U.S Auto Sales Tax feature, a game-changing tool developed to simplify the often complicated sales tax process. Powered by Avalara, Xero’s new feature provides automatic calculation of sales tax rates and detailed sales tax reports. Further enhancing traceability, it offers transaction review and tracing and even boasts of automated e-filing capabilities. This feature, targeted at retailers and wholesalers, can potentially revolutionize their existing mechanisms, enabling them to work smarter, not harder.

For those eager to harness the power of U.S Auto Sales Tax, keep your calendars marked for the 28th of August 2023, when a limited preview of this robust tool becomes available.

Delving into Xero’s inventory arsenal, we turn the spotlight to Inventory Plus. This state-of-the-art inventory management system is currently in beta but promises to streamline operations with seamless sales channel integration, easy order fulfillment and a simplified dashboard providing valuable insights.

Contributing further to simplifying business management, Xero previewed its upcoming W9 management solution, equipping businesses with an easier way to handle the often daunting task of managing 1099s. This beneficial tool aims to centralize requests, store history, personalise requests, and increase security while almost eliminating the scope for errors.
